Output 9c56172fee0b55909d40702e99d07a0b99ec246da8f6a9ec7eb65ef2758b2281:0

value
28791706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8e8f5149c3c59dab2e188bc0228d0c53a5db9e OP_EQUAL
address
3Bb1gVWZf6cd265MkdoL2SViQ6ejXq2FJ4
transaction
9c56172fee0b55909d40702e99d07a0b99ec246da8f6a9ec7eb65ef2758b2281
spent
true